# Edit an image

> Resize, crop, draw, add shapes, and apply filters to images directly in the Kameleoon Media library Image editor.

The Kameleoon Media library includes a robust Image editor that lets you modify images directly within the platform. This article will help you access and use the editor.

## Access the Image editor

* **During upload:** After uploading a new image, the editor will open automatically, letting you make adjustments before saving the image to your library.
* **From the Media library:** To edit an existing image in the library, hover over an image and click the three-dots menu. Select **Edit Image** from the dropdown menu. The Image editor opens.

## Structure of the Image editor

* **The top toolbar** includes options to:
  * Resize
  * Crop
  * Flip
* **The left toolbar** provides more in-depth editing tools, such as:
  * Frame
  * Draw
  * Shapes
  * Filters
* **In the top right** of the Image editor, you can expand the pop-up, undo your changes, reapply them, or swap the current image for another without leaving the editor.

## Edit image content

Use the toolbar to make changes to your image. You can resize, crop, add shapes, or apply filters.

### Frame

Here, you can resize, crop, or flip your image.

#### Resize

To resize your image, click **Resize**. Enter the desired dimensions or use the slider to adjust the image's size.

#### Crop

Select **Crop** if you need to trip your image's edges. You can choose a preset dimension or freely select the crop area.

#### Flip

Use the **Flip** tool to flip your image horizontally or vertically.

### Draw

Use **Draw** to draw on your images. Select the brush size and color to personalize your drawing.

### Shapes

Insert shapes using the **Shapes** tool. You can adjust the size, color, and position of the shapes as needed.

### Filters

Apply filters to your image using **Filters**. You can also adjust your image's brightness, noise, or threshold by clicking **Adjustments**.

## Edit image details

You can edit metadata such as the image name, tags, or description by clicking **Edit Image Details** at the bottom of the editor.

## Save or discard changes

* **Save image**: Click **Save image** to save your changes and return to the Media library.
* **Discard changes**: Close the editor without saving to discard your changes.
